Can Radeon RX 7800 XT run The Veil of the Forgotten?
GreatThe Radeon RX 7800 XT handles The Veil of the Forgotten well at 1080p, delivering approximately 202 FPS at High settings — above the 60 FPS target for smooth gameplay. It can also achieve smooth 1440p at around 151 FPS.
The Veil of the Forgotten – Radeon RX 7800 XT FPS Data
| Quality | 1080p | 1440p | 4K |
|---|---|---|---|
| Low | 315 fps | 237 fps | 126 fps |
| Medium | 252 fps | 189 fps | 101 fps |
| High | 202 fps | 151 fps | 81 fps |
| Ultra | 164 fps | 123 fps | 66 fps |
Estimated FPS · actual performance may vary based on drivers and settings

To enjoy this psychological adventure, an entry-level GPU like the GTX 1650 or RX 6500 XT is recommended. This allows for decent performance at 1080p resolution with medium settings, ensuring a smooth visual experience without overwhelming your system. For players with more powerful GPUs, such as the GTX 1660 or RX 6600, targeting high settings at 1080p or even 1440p will enhance the atmospheric visuals, making the dark island environment more immersive.
The game's demands are quite accessible, making it suitable for a wide range of hardware configurations. If you're on a budget or using integrated graphics, you might still manage to play at lower settings, but expect reduced visual fidelity. Overall, it's a great choice for those looking to dive into a captivating narrative without needing the latest high-end hardware. For the best experience, aim for at least a GTX 1650 and 8 GB of RAM to fully appreciate the game's eerie atmosphere and psychological challenges.
